How fit affects golf polo performance

Fit is one of the most important and most misunderstood aspects of a golf polo.

Freedom of movement

A well-fitted polo allows unrestricted shoulder rotation and torso movement through the swing. Polos that are too tight across the chest or arms can restrict motion, while overly loose fits can feel cumbersome and distracting.

Modern performance fits strike a balance, offering structure without compression.

Consistency over a full round

A polo that maintains its shape and fit after several hours of wear contributes to consistent comfort. This is especially important in warm conditions where movement and heat amplify any issues.

Premium apparel is designed to hold its fit rather than stretch or sag as the round progresses.

Why fabric choice is critical

Fabric selection is where performance golf polos separate themselves from casual alternatives.

Breathability and moisture control

Performance fabrics are engineered to manage moisture and promote airflow. This helps regulate body temperature and keeps you comfortable during long rounds.

Durability and feel

The best fabrics feel soft against the skin while maintaining durability through repeated washing and wear. Cheap materials may feel acceptable initially but often degrade quickly.

Caring for performance golf polos

Even the best golf polos require proper care to maintain performance.

Washing and storage

Wash polos on a gentle cycle and avoid high heat, which can break down performance fibres. Air drying helps preserve fit and breathability.
